Bailey Bridge Exam / Bailey Bridge Exam
Questions And Answers




Given a 210-foot TT bridge. What is the position of launching-nose links? - ---
✔✔✔ANSWER----30x40ft


How many personnel does the routine repair detail consists of? - ---
✔✔✔ANSWER----6


How many personnel does the maintenance party usually consist of for important
bridges subject to enemy action? - ---✔✔✔ANSWER----entire assembly
crew


What is the required safety setback on an unprepared abutment if the bank height
is 6 feet? - ---✔✔✔ANSWER----(1.5) 6ft = 9ft

, Given a 140-foot TS bridge with grillage type 1 on both the near shore (NS) and far
shore (FS). The far-bank seat is level with the near-bank seat. What is the position
of the launching-nose links? - ---✔✔✔ANSWER----20x40ft



How is the initial bridge length determined? - ---✔✔✔ANSWER----adding
the width of the gap, the safety setbacks, and the
roller clearances.



What is the purpose of construction rollers? - ---✔✔✔ANSWER----Aid in
inserting the launching-nose links and provide clearance between the links and
the ground


How many NCOs and enlisted members are on the transom crew to construct a TT
Bailey bridge? - ---✔✔✔ANSWER----2 NCO, 28 enlisted



What are the different types of stringers? - ---✔✔✔ANSWER----plain,
button



How many unloading parties are needed for a 100-foot DS bridge? - ---
✔✔✔ANSWER----5
